Webseiten mit 404 Fehler finden

  • andreas: Da gab es nicht viel zu löschen. Ich habe hier ein unbranded Nightly 50.1.0 mit einem eigenen Profil. die Zahlen schwanken immer noch.

    @Sören: Der angegebene Link führt eindeutig zu einer anderen Adresse, es ist in der Liste aber nicht angegeben, dass es sich um eine Weiterleitung handelt. Die funktionierenden Links, hauptsächlich Mozilla und auch andere Links z. B. aus meiner Lesezeichenleiste erhalten den Statuscode 404, obwohl sie funktionieren.

    Übersetzer für Obersorbisch und Niedersorbisch auf pontoon.mozilla.org u.a. für Firefox, Firefox für Android, Firefox für iOS, Firefox Klar/Focus für iOS und Android, Thunderbird, Pootle, Django, LibreOffice, LibreOffice Onlinehilfe, WordPress

  • Ich weiß nicht, ob du meine Datei schon heruntergeladen hast, die ich dir zu meiner PN an dich hochgeladen habe. Schaue dir in erster Linie alle Einträge under "Bookmarks Toolbar" an und alles, was irgendwie zu Mozilla gehört, also in erster Linie .mozilla.org mit seinen Subdomains developer, wiki, addons, bugzilla usw. Selbst die Seite mit den Unbranded Builds, von wo ich mir den Firefox zum Testen geholt habe, wird mit 404 gekennzeichnet (allerletzter Eintrag).

    Übersetzer für Obersorbisch und Niedersorbisch auf pontoon.mozilla.org u.a. für Firefox, Firefox für Android, Firefox für iOS, Firefox Klar/Focus für iOS und Android, Thunderbird, Pootle, Django, LibreOffice, LibreOffice Onlinehilfe, WordPress

  • Zu Facebook und Twitter: Ich habe hier schon länger Probleme mit beiden; genauer: Twitter geht inzwischen (toi, toi, toi) wieder gut. An manchen Tagen geht alles prima, an anderen zicken sie rum. Nach einem Neuladen, manchmal leider auch erst beim zweiten oder dritten Mal, geht es dann aber gewöhnlich. Jetzt gerade eben wie zum Beweis erhielt ich bei einer Facebook-Seite nach unter 1 Sekunde die Fehlermeldung, dass ein Content-Encoding-Problem vorliege.

    So etwas kannst Du, Sören, gar nicht abfangen, sondern nur in der Doku darauf hinweisen. Es mischen sich ja unter Umständen auch Adblocker und Antivirenprogramme ungefragt ein, so dass die Abfragezeiten eventuell zu lang werden.

  • Eine neue Vorab-Version (0.4) steht ab sofort zum Testen bereit:
    https://git.agenedia.com/firefox-add-on…checker-0.4.xpi

    Änderungen seit Version 0.3:

    • Lesezeichen müssen für die Überprüfung mit http:// oder https:// beginnen (es werden nicht mehr nur explizit places: und about: ausgeschlossen).
    • Für die Überprüfung der Lesezeichen wird nicht länger der Browser-Cache berücksichtigt.
    • Bereits nach erfolgreicher Zählung der Lesezeichen wird die Fortschrittsanzeige nun bereits ein kleines Stück ausgefüllt. Außerdem wird ab diesem Punkt der Button deaktiviert und erst am Ende wieder aktiviert.
    • Wenn ein Lesezeichen gelöscht wird, werden direkt auch die Zähler in der Statusleiste geändert.
    • Das Löschen eines Lesezeichens muss nun bestätigt werden.
    • Gibt es keine zu beanstandenden Lesezeichen, wird eine entsprechende Meldung angezeigt.
    • Neues Feature: Die Eingabe von "bookmarks check" in die Adressleiste ruft ab sofort die Oberfläche der Erweiterung auf (siehe Screenshot; erfordert mindestens Firefox 52).
    • Bis auf die Statuszeile alle Stellen des Add-ons übersetzbar gemacht (noch kein finales UI, daher auch noch keine finalen Texte, sollte also noch nicht übersetzt werden).
    • diverse interne Optimierungen.
    • Update von Mozilla web-ext 0.6 auf Version 0.7.

    Alle Code-Änderungen seit Version 0.3:
    https://git.agenedia.com/firefox-add-on…fcba14bd#diff-0

  • Ich bekomme, wenn ich über about:debugging gehe folgende Fehlermeldung :

    Code
    There was an error during installation: Component returned failure code: 0x8052000b (NS_ERROR_FILE_CORRUPTED) [nsIZipReader.open]


    Alles zurück ... Datei wurde fehlerhaft geladen ;)

    Chromebook Lenovo IdeaPad Flex 5 - chromeOS 122 (Stable Channel) - Linux Debian Bookworm: Firefox ESR 115.8.0 und Firefox Nightly, Beta und Main Release (Mozilla PPA), Android 13: Firefox Nightly und Firefox (Main Release)

    Smartphone - Firefox Main Release, Firefox Nightly, Firefox Klar (Main Release)

  • Stimmt, jetzt wo du es erwähnst fällt mir das auch auf ;) :klasse:

    Chromebook Lenovo IdeaPad Flex 5 - chromeOS 122 (Stable Channel) - Linux Debian Bookworm: Firefox ESR 115.8.0 und Firefox Nightly, Beta und Main Release (Mozilla PPA), Android 13: Firefox Nightly und Firefox (Main Release)

    Smartphone - Firefox Main Release, Firefox Nightly, Firefox Klar (Main Release)

  • Eine Verständnisfrage:
    Wieso wird eine https-Seite auf eine http-Seite weitergeleitet?

    [attachment=0]Herzstiftung.PNG[/attachment]
    Ich denke, dieses sollte so nicht sein.

    Freundliche Grüße
    Barbara

    ____________

  • Dann wundert es mich, das ich einige Seiten über https und andere nur über http aufrufen kann. Obwohl der Aufruf über https möglich ist.
    Seltsam. Andere Seiten kann ich nur über http aufrufen.

    Freundliche Grüße
    Barbara

    ____________

  • Zitat von BarbaraZ-

    Dann wundert es mich, das ich einige Seiten über https und andere nur über http aufrufen kann. Obwohl der Aufruf über https möglich ist.
    Seltsam. Andere Seiten kann ich nur über http aufrufen.

    Der Aufruf der Seite in deinem Beispiel ist eben nicht über HTTPS möglich. Schau mal in die Adressleiste, was passiert, wenn du das aufrufst. Du wirst weitergeleitet auf die gleiche Domain, aber ohne HTTPS. Man kann nicht jede Seite über HTTPS aufrufen. Das liegt vollständig in der Verantwortung der Webseite, was passiert. In dem Fall hast du Glück, dass die Betreiber eine Weiterleitung eingerichtet haben. Meistens, wenn eine Seite nicht über HTTPS erreichbar ist und man es trotzdem versucht, bekommt man nur eine Fehlermeldung des Browsers.

    Zitat von 2002Andreas

    Ohne den Cache wird mir A.Topal auch nicht mehr als Fehler 404, sondern nur noch als von Http zu Https angezeigt.

    index.png

    Und Facebook erscheint gar nicht mehr.

    Perfekt, danke für die Rückmeldung!

    Zitat von Road-Runner

    1.png

    Wieso wird hier eine Weiterleitung angezeigt? Ich sehe keinen Unterschied zwischen den URLs.

    Ansonsten: Klasse Arbeit von Sören.

    Ui, das ist spannend. Und ich kann das mit dieser URL als Lesezeichen reproduzieren. Werde ich untersuchen.

  • Also ich kann sagen, dass hier kein Fehler der Erweiterung vorliegt, weil die Erweiterung das verarbeitet, was sie vom Server erhält. Siehe der folgende Screenshot, wenn man die URL einfach mal in die Adressleiste von Firefox eingibt:

    [attachment=0]Bildschirmfoto 2017-01-06 um 14.05.42.png[/attachment]

    Man sieht, dass zunächst eine Weiterleitung erfolgt (302) und dann die Seite nicht gefunden wird (404). Die URL ist in beiden Fällen absolut identisch. Auf den ersten Blick ergibt das nicht viel Sinn, aber auf den zweiten Blick sieht man im Quelltext, dass da ein etwas eigenartiges Konstrukt zum Einsatz kommt.

    Der Quelltext beinhaltet nicht mehr als ein iFrame einer Parking-Page des Hosters GoDaddy. Das iFrame wiederum besitzt nicht mehr als eine Weiterleitung. Und diese Weiterleitung führt auf eine Seite, die es nicht gibt.

    So einen Käse kann ich per Erweiterung nicht erkennen und abfangen. Was ich machen kann: bei einem erkannten Redirect überprüfen, ob alte und neue URL identisch sind. Es ergibt keinen Sinn, eine Weiterleitung anzuzeigen, wenn die vorgeschlagene Korrektur keinen Unterschied zum Original macht. Darum sollte ich das abfangen.

    Die Frage ist nur, was soll ich dann machen? Einen Fehler anzeigen oder gar nicht anzeigen, obwohl das Lesezeichen nicht funktioniert? Ich fürchte, ich muss mit der zweiten Option gehen, weil ich nicht weiß, ob es garanatiert immer ein Fehler ist, wenn eine Weiterleitung erkannt wird, aber alte und neue URL identisch sind.

    Nachtrag: oder ich ordne das in die Kategorie unbekannt und beschreibe es so, dass der Status nicht ermittelt werden kann.

  • Eine neue Vorab-Version (0.5) steht ab sofort zum Testen bereit:
    https://git.agenedia.com/firefox-add-on…checker-0.5.xpi

    Änderungen seit Version 0.4:

    • Kategorisiere einen Redirect zu einer identischen URL als unbekannten Fehler.
    • Erkannte Weiterleitungen können nun per Klick für ein einzelnes Lesezeichen automatisch korrigiert werden.
    • Option, um alle erkannten Weiterleitungen mit nur einem einzigen Klick automatisch korrigieren zu lassen.
    • Internes Limit von 10.000 Lesezeichen optional gemacht und standardmäßig deaktiviert.
    • Nicht länger die Zähler in der Statusleiste reduzieren, wenn ein Lesezeichen entfernt wird (war neu in v0.3).
    • Eingabe von "bookmarks check" in die Adressleiste (neu in v0.3) öffnet nicht länger nur die Oberfläche, sondern führt automatisch direkt eine Überprüfung aller Lesezeichen aus (Firefox 52+).
    • Neues Kommando für die Adressleiste: "bookmarks check-errors": Prüft nur auf Fehler (Firefox 52+).
    • Neues Kommando für die Adressleiste: "bookmarks check-warnings": Prüft nur auf Warnungen (Firefox 52+).
    • Neues Kommando für die Adressleiste: "bookmarks check-unknowns": Prüft nur auf Lesezeichen, deren Status nicht ermittelt werden kann (Firefox 52+).
    • diverse interne Optimierungen.

    Alle Code-Änderungen seit Version 0.4:
    https://git.agenedia.com/firefox-add-on…a7f9df72#diff-0